linuxapache基本命令行
-
1. ls命令:用于列出目录中的文件和子目录。
2. cd命令:用于更改当前工作目录。
3. pwd命令:用于显示当前工作目录的路径。
4. mkdir命令:用于创建新的目录。
5. rmdir命令:用于删除空目录。
6. cp命令:用于复制文件和目录。
7. mv命令:用于移动文件和目录,或重命名文件和目录。
8. touch命令:用于创建新的空文件。
9. rm命令:用于删除文件和目录。
10. cat命令:用于显示文件的内容。
11. head命令:用于显示文件的前几行内容。
12. tail命令:用于显示文件的末尾几行内容。
13. grep命令:用于在文件中查找匹配的文本。
14. wget命令:用于从网上下载文件。
15. chmod命令:用于更改文件和目录的权限。
16. chown命令:用于更改文件和目录的所有者。
17. chgrp命令:用于更改文件和目录的组。
18. ps命令:用于显示当前正在运行的进程。
19. top命令:用于实时监视进程的系统资源使用情况。
20. service命令:用于管理系统服务。
21. systemctl命令:用于控制systemd系统。
22. ifconfig命令:用于显示和配置网络接口。
23. ping命令:用于测试网络连接。
24. netstat命令:用于显示网络统计数据。
25. ssh命令:用于远程登录到服务器。
26. scp命令:用于在本地和远程主机之间复制文件。
27. su命令:用于切换到其他用户身份。
28. sudo命令:用于以超级用户的权限执行命令。
29. df命令:用于显示磁盘空间使用情况。
30. du命令:用于计算目录和文件的磁盘使用情况。以上是在Linux环境下常用的基本命令行,可以帮助用户完成日常的文件管理、系统管理、网络管理等各种任务。熟练掌握这些命令可以提高工作效率,并且为进一步学习和使用其他高级命令打下基础。
2年前 -
Linux系统中,Apache是一个常用的Web服务器软件。在使用Apache时,我们可以通过命令行来管理和控制Apache服务器。下面是一些基本的Apache命令行操作:
1. 启动和停止Apache服务器:
– 启动Apache服务器:`sudo systemctl start apache2`
– 停止Apache服务器:`sudo systemctl stop apache2`
– 重启Apache服务器:`sudo systemctl restart apache2`2. 配置Apache服务器:
– 编辑主配置文件:`sudo nano /etc/apache2/apache2.conf`,或者`sudo nano /etc/httpd/conf/httpd.conf`(具体文件路径根据系统而定)
– 编辑虚拟主机配置文件:`sudo nano /etc/apache2/sites-available/your_domain.conf`
– 查看Apache服务器版本:`apache2 -v`3. 管理虚拟主机:
– 启用虚拟主机:`sudo a2ensite your_domain.conf`
– 禁用虚拟主机:`sudo a2dissite your_domain.conf`
– 重新加载Apache配置文件:`sudo systemctl reload apache2`4. 查看Apache服务器状态:
– 查看Apache服务器状态:`sudo systemctl status apache2`
– 查看Apache服务器日志:`sudo tail -f /var/log/apache2/error.log`5. 其他常用命令:
– 查看Apache服务器的进程ID:`sudo systemctl status apache2`
– 查看正在监听的端口:`sudo netstat -tlnp | grep apache2`这些是一些常用的基本Apache命令行操作,可以帮助你管理和控制Apache服务器。当然,还有更多的高级操作和配置需要根据实际需求进行学习和探索。
2年前 -
Linux系统下使用Apache服务器的基本命令行操作可以分为以下几个部分:安装Apache、启动和停止Apache服务、配置Apache、管理Apache的虚拟主机。
一、安装Apache
1. 在Linux系统上打开终端,以root用户身份登录。
2. 使用以下命令安装Apache服务器:
“`
sudo apt-get update
sudo apt-get install apache2
“`
安装完成后,Apache服务器就已经成功安装在你的系统中了。二、启动和停止Apache服务
1. 启动Apache服务:
“`
sudo systemctl start apache2
“`
2. 停止Apache服务:
“`
sudo systemctl stop apache2
“`
三、配置Apache1. 主配置文件
Apache的主配置文件位于/etc/apache2/apache2.conf。你可以使用以下命令编辑该文件:
“`
sudo nano /etc/apache2/apache2.conf
“`
2. 网站配置文件
每个网站都有一个配置文件,位于/etc/apache2/sites-available目录下。你可以使用以下命令来编辑该文件:
“`
sudo nano /etc/apache2/sites-available/your_website.conf
“`
编辑完成后,需要使用以下命令启用该网站:
“`
sudo a2ensite your_website.conf
“`
然后重新加载Apache配置文件:
“`
sudo systemctl reload apache2
“`
四、管理Apache的虚拟主机1. 创建虚拟主机配置文件
在/etc/apache2/sites-available目录中创建一个新的虚拟主机配置文件,比如your_website.conf。2. 编辑虚拟主机配置文件
使用以下命令来编辑该文件:
“`
sudo nano /etc/apache2/sites-available/your_website.conf
“`
在该文件中配置你的虚拟主机信息,包括域名、目录等。3. 启用虚拟主机配置文件
使用以下命令来启用该虚拟主机配置文件:
“`
sudo a2ensite your_website.conf
“`
然后重新加载Apache配置文件:
“`
sudo systemctl reload apache2
“`以上就是在Linux系统下使用Apache服务器的基本命令行操作。通过这些命令,你可以方便地安装、启动、停止Apache服务,配置Apache的主配置文件和虚拟主机,以满足你的网站需求。
2年前